Output d7385929330c305395f4f017a37676d64e62e67ffa340ece21008466c4534011:725

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7629a9570754201babdfc412c427f2de476de0f5cbe8474272c9d408e826b7f0
address
bc1pwc56j4c82ssph27lcsfvgfljmerkmc84e05ywsnje82q36pxklcqza5aw5
transaction
d7385929330c305395f4f017a37676d64e62e67ffa340ece21008466c4534011
spent
true